KIN PE 3, INTRODUCTION TO EXERCISE PHYSIOLOGY I    3 UNITS

Transfer: UC*, CSU • Prerequisite: None.

This is an introduction to the principles of exercise physiology. The course will discuss topics related to exercise and human performance. These topics will include: energy transfer and utilization, nutrition, and measurement of human performance as it relates to physical activity and life-long wellness.

KIN PE 10, FITNESS LAB (1,1,1,1,)    1 UNIT

Transfer: UC, CSU • Prerequisite: None.

This is an open-entry laboratory physical fitness course designed to develop and encourage positive attitudes and habits in a personalized exercise program. The program is designed to work the five health-related components of fitness. The primary training activity is aerobic weight training utilizing a sequence of body specific weight lifting machines and stationary bicycles organized into an “aerobic super circuit.” The aerobic super circuit combines low intensity, high repetition weight training with aerobic activity stations. Additional activity is available in an aerobics machine area (treadmills, steppers, bikes) and a stretching flexibility area.
